Détails du cours

Retrofitting Fundamentals: An introduction to the principles and practices of retrofitting for cultural institutions, including an overview of heritage preservation and the importance of retrofitting. • Assessing Cultural Institutions: Techniques for evaluating cultural institutions to determine their retrofitting needs, including condition assessments, seismic risk analysis, and structural evaluation. • Retrofitting Techniques: A survey of retrofitting methods and techniques, including base isolation, energy dissipation devices, and strengthening of existing structures. • Materials and Systems: An exploration of the materials and systems used in retrofitting cultural institutions, including traditional and innovative materials, and their impact on heritage preservation. • Construction Management: Best practices for managing retrofitting projects, including scheduling, budgeting, and coordination with stakeholders. • Regulatory and Legal Considerations: An overview of the regulatory and legal frameworks that govern retrofitting of cultural institutions, including building codes, historic preservation laws, and environmental regulations. • Public Engagement and Outreach: Strategies for engaging the public in retrofitting projects, including communication, education, and outreach. • Sustainability and Resilience: The role of retrofitting in promoting sustainability and resilience in cultural institutions, including energy efficiency, water conservation, and disaster preparedness.
